工程碩士就業前景非常不錯,單證的都是考的都不是一月份的聯考的在職研究生。
工程是一門研究用工程化方法構建和維護有效的、實用的和高質量的的學科。它涉及程序設計語言、資料庫、開發工具、系統平台、標准、設計模式等方面。
Ⅱ 請簡述軟體工程研究的內容
軟體工程
軟體工程是一門研究用工程化方法構建和維護有效的、實用的和高質量的軟體的學科。它涉及程序設計語言、資料庫、軟體開發工具、系統平台、標准、設計模式等方面。
在現代社會中,軟體應用於多個方面。典型的軟體有電子郵件、嵌入式系統、人機界面、辦公套件、操作系統、編譯器、資料庫、游戲等。同時,各個行業幾乎都有計算機軟體的應用,如工業、農業、銀行、航空、政府部門等。這些應用促進了經濟和社會的發展,也提高了工作效率和生活效率 。
Ⅲ 軟體工程研究的內容及面臨的問題
軟體工程的研究內容:軟體工程的主要研究內容是軟體開發技術和軟體開發過程管理兩個方面。在軟體開發技術方面,主要研究軟體開發方法、軟體開發過程、軟體開發工具和技術。在軟體開發過程管理方面,主要研究軟體工程經濟學和軟體管理學。技術與管理是軟體開發中缺一不可的兩個方面。沒有科學的管理,再先進的技術也不能充分發揮作用。
軟體工程面臨的問題:
(1)對軟體開發成本和進度的估計常常很不準 確。
(2)用戶常對「已完成的」軟體系統不滿意。
(3)軟體產品的質量往往靠不住。
(4) 軟體常常很難維護。
(5)軟體常常缺乏適當的文檔資料。
(6)軟體開發生產率提高的 速度,遠遠跟不上計算機應用迅速普及深入的趨勢。
(7)軟體成本在計算機系統總成本 中所佔的比例逐年上升。
Ⅳ 誰有《軟體工程——實踐者的研究方法》全本電子書下載百度網盤資源
《軟體工程——實踐者的研究方法》全本電子書
鏈接:
提取碼:v4vy
Ⅳ 軟體工程的研究領域
軟體架構
軟體設計方法
軟體領域建模
軟體工程決策支持
軟體工程教育
軟體測試技術
自動化的軟體設計和合成
基於組件的軟體工程
計算機支持的協同工作
編程語言和軟體工程
計算機網路
信息與通信安全
計算機圖形學與人機交互
多媒體技術應用
人工智慧與識別
嵌入式軟體與應用
自動控制
分布式計算與網格計算
雲計算技術
存儲技術
資料庫技術研究
計算機輔助設計與應用技術
大數據分析與處理
Ⅵ 軟體工程的開發方法
國外大的軟體公司和機構一直在研究軟體開發方法這個概念性的東西,而且也提出了很多實際的開發方法,比如:生命周期法、原型化方法、面向對象方法等等。下面介紹幾種流行的開發方法:
結構化方法
結構化開發方法是由E.Yourdon 和 L.L.Constantine 提出的,即所謂的SASD 方 法, 也可稱為面向功能的軟體開發方法或面向數據流的軟體開發方法。Yourdon方法是80年代 使用最廣泛的軟體開發方法。它首先用結構化分析(SA)對軟體進行需求分析,然後用結構化設計(SD)方法進行總體設計,最後是結構化編程(SP)。它給出了兩類典型的軟體結構(變換型和事務型)使軟體開發的成功率大大提高。
面向數據結構的軟體開發方法
Jackson方法是最典型的面向數據結構的軟體開發方法,Jackson方法把問題分解為可由三種基本結構形式表示的各部分的層次結構。三種基本的結構形式就是順序、選擇和重復。三種數據結構可以進行組合,形成復雜的結構體系。這一方法從目標系統的輸入、輸出數據結構入手,導出程序框架結構,再補充其它細節,就可得到完整的程序結構圖。這一方法對輸入、輸出數據結構明確的中小型系統特別有效,如商業應用中的文件表格處理。該方法也可與其它方法結合,用於模塊的詳細設計。
面向問題的分析法
PAM(Problem Analysis Method)是80年代末由日立公司提出的一種軟體開發方法。 它的基本思想是考慮到輸入、輸出數據結構,指導系統的分解,在系統分析指導下逐步綜 合。這一方法的具體步驟是:從輸入、輸出數據結構導出基本處理框;分析這些處理框之間的先後關系;按先後關系逐步綜合處理框,直到畫出整個系統的PAD圖。這一方法本質上是綜合的自底向上的方法,但在逐步綜合之前已進行了有目的的分解,這個目的就是充分考慮系統的輸入、輸出數據結構。PAM方法的另一個優點是使用PAD圖。這是一種二維樹形結構圖,是到目前為止最好的詳細設計表示方法之一。當然由於在輸入、輸出數據結構與整個系統之間同樣存在著鴻溝,這一方法仍只適用於中小型問題。
原型化方法
產生原型化方法的原因很多,主要隨著我們系統開發經驗的增多,我們也發現並非所有的需求都能夠預先定義而且反復修改是不可避免的。當然能夠採用原型化方法是因為開發工具的快速發展,比如用VB,DELPHI等工具我們可以迅速的開發出一個可以讓用戶看的見、摸的著的系統框架,這樣,對於計算機不是很熟悉的用戶就可以根據這個樣板提出自己的需求。
Ⅶ 誰有軟體工程實踐者的研究方法第七或八版的本科教學版pdf
https://pan..com/s/1dEBrS3Z
eh9l
Ⅷ 軟體工程主要研究什麼問題,有哪些理論或技術有什麼實際應用
軟體工程 (Software Engineering,簡稱為SE)是一門研究用工程化方法構建和維護有效的、實用的和高質量的軟體的學科。
它涉及到程序設計語言,資料庫,軟體開發工具,系統平台,標准,設計模式等方面。在現代社會中,軟體應用於多個方面。
典型的軟體比如有電子郵件,嵌入式系統,人機界面,辦公套件,操作系統,編譯器,資料庫,游戲等。同時,各個行業幾乎都有計算機軟體的應用,比如工業,農業,銀行,航空,政府部門等。這些應用促進了經濟和社會的發展,使得人們的工作更加高效,同時提高了生活質量。
培養目標
培養學生系統理解和掌握計算機網路與軟體工程的理論、相關知識和技能,能構建網路、分析和排除常見網路故障,維護網路的安全和正常運行;能從事計算機應用軟體的測試、開發,計算機網路系統管理與維護工作的應用型專業人才。
主要課程
計算機基礎與操作應用、計算機組裝維修與區域網構建、計算機網路工程、電子商務、Cisco CCNA網路工程、REDHAT Linux操作系統、計算機網路安全分析管理、WEB網站設計、SQL Server資料庫編程與管理、ASP商務網站與企業應用系統開發、VB企業應用系統開發、.NET編程與系統開發。
就業方向
本專業學生畢業後可以從事各級各類企、事業單位的辦公自動化處理、計算機安裝與維護、網頁製作、計算機網路和專業伺服器的維護管理和開發工作、動態商務網站開發與管理、軟體測試與開發及計算機相關設備的商品貿易等方面的有關工作。
Ⅸ 論文中研究方法及可行性分析應該怎麼寫 軟體工程化專業
反駁論證,即揭露對方在論證過程中的邏輯錯誤,如大前提、小前提與結論的矛盾,對方各論點之間的矛盾,論點與論據之間矛盾等等。
立論和駁論都是一種證明,無非一個是從正面證明其正確,而另一個是從反面證明其錯誤。它們可以使用基本相同的論證方法。